Faktor-Faktor Yang Mempengaruhi Tax Avoidance Dengan Kepemilikan Manajerial Sebagai Pemoderasi Pada Perusahaan Pertambangan Di Bursa Efek Indonesia (BEI) Periode 2015-2019 Alya Zulfa Cahyani; Syahril Djaddang; Mombang Sihite; Yayan Hendayana

Abstract

This study examines the effect of thin capitalization, capital intensity, and fiscal loss compensation on tax avoidance and to examine managerial ownership in moderating the effect of thin capitalization on tax avoidance in mining sector companies listed on the indonesia stock exchange in 2015-2019. This study uses a sample of 35 mining sector companies listed on the indonesia stock exchange for the 2015-2019 period with the sampling technique using the purposive sampling method and the research data using secondary data. Methods data analysis uses moderated regression analysis (mra) with spss 25.0 software. The results of this study indicate that thin capitalization has a positive and significant effect on tax avoidance, while capital intensity has a negative and significant effect on tax avoidance and fiscal loss compensation has no effect on tax avoidance and managerial ownership weakens the effect of thin capitalization on tax avoidance. The control variable, namely roa, has a negative and significant effect on tax avoidance and company size has no effect on tax avoidance.

The Mediating Effect of Islamic Marketing Capabilities in The Relationship Between Entrepreneurial Orientation And Firm Performance at Handicraft SMEs In West Java Hendayana, Yayan; Puspaningtyas Faeni, Dewi; El-Kafafi, Siham

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to determine the influence of entrepreneurial orientation and market orientation on Islamic marketing capabilities and their impact on the performance of SMEs in the handicraft sector in West Java. The population in this study is the managers of leather craft SMEs with a sample of 160 respondents using the purposive sampling method. Data analysis using the help of SmartPLS program. The results showed that entrepreneurial orientation had a significant positive effect on Islamic marketing ability, Islamic marketing ability had a significant positive effect on SME performance, and Islamic marketing ability mediated the influence of entrepreneurial orientation on the performance of SMEs in the leather handicraft sector in West Java. The results of this study recommend to SMEs in the handicraft sector in West Java to continue to improve entrepreneurial orientation to support the improvement of the ability to market their products, so that overall business performance continues to grow.

Sustainability and Technology Use in SMEs: A Pathway to Green Innovation : Keberlanjutan dan Penggunaan Teknologi pada UMKM: Jalan Menuju Inovasi Ramah Lingkungan Rieki Indra Bratamanggala; Yayan Hendayana

Abstract

This study examines the critical role of green innovation and technology adoption in small and medium enterprises (SMEs) as pathways to sustainability. With increasing pressure from consumers and regulatory bodies for environmentally responsible practices, SMEs are facing both challenges and opportunities in implementing sustainable technologies. The research highlights key barriers such as high initial costs and limited technological knowledge, alongside the potential long-term benefits, including cost savings and enhanced competitiveness. Utilizing a systematic literature review, this paper identifies strategies for overcoming these barriers, emphasizing the importance of integrating green technologies into business models. Moreover, the findings suggest that government support, including subsidies and training, is essential for fostering an ecosystem conducive to sustainable innovation. The study concludes that by embracing green innovation, SMEs can not only comply with environmental standards but also differentiate themselves in the market, ultimately contributing to global sustainability goals.
Kewirausahaan Sosial sebagai Solusi Inovatif untuk Mengatasi Masalah Kemiskinan di Pedesaan Sulung Anom; Yayan Hendayana

Abstract

Poverty in rural Indonesia is higher compared to urban areas where around 12.82% of rural residents live below the poverty line. Rural communities are often unable to exploit existing economic potential due to lack of access to markets, technology and adequate infrastructure. This study aims to analyze the role of social entrepreneurship in addressing poverty in rural areas of Indonesia through a literature review method. Social entrepreneurship is viewed as an innovative solution that not only focuses on financial profit but also on social impact, empowering rural communities, creating jobs, and improving living standards. Based on the review of 9 relevant journals, the study found that social entrepreneurship in rural areas can increase income by utilizing local potential such as agricultural products and handicrafts. However, the main challenges faced include limited infrastructure, access to technology, and insufficient skill training for rural communities. Therefore, to achieve significant impact, social entrepreneurship requires clear policy support, adequate training, and the development of social capital at the community level. This study concludes that social entrepreneurship holds great potential in reducing poverty in rural areas, but it requires an inclusive and integrated approach to provide long-term benefits for rural communities.

The Influence of the Blue Economy on National Economic Growth Qibtiyana, Mariyatul; Sastrodiharjo, Istianingsih; Hendayana, Yayan

Abstract

Economic growth is the main focus of the country's development, especially measured through Gross Domestic Product (GDP). In the Indonesian context, the blue economy concept is a promising strategy because of the abundant potential of marine resources. This study aims to analyze the influence of the blue economy on economic growth in Indonesia. Through a literature review, it is revealed that the government has implemented various innovative policies and financial instruments to support the blue economy. The research results show that the blue economy has a significant influence on economic growth. However, the challenge of maximizing the benefits of marine resources while maintaining environmental sustainability remains the main focus. By maintaining the sustainability of marine resources, Indonesia can build a strong and sustainable blue economy, providing long-term economic and social benefits for its people.
